Your company has decided that its capital budget during the coming year will be $20 million. Its optimal capital structure is 60 percent equity and 40 percent debt. Its earnings before interest and taxes (EBIT) are projected to be $34.667 million for the year. The company has $200 million of assets; its average interest rate on outstanding debt is 10 percent; and its tax rate is 40 percent. If the company follows the residual distribution policy (with all distributions in the form of dividends) and maintains the same capital structure, what will its dividend payout ratio be?
A) 15%
B) 20%
C) 25%
D) 30%
E) 35%
